SENIOR .NET DEVELOPER to join our team. If you're excited to be part of a winning team, CirrusLabs ( http://www.cirruslabs.io ) is a great place to grow your career.
Experience - 6-8 years
Location - Hyderabad
Shift Timings - 11 am - 8 pm
Must have skills - .net with C sharp, Angular 16+, Web API, Azure services
KEY SKILLS
- You obtained your degree in a technical field;
- 5+ years of experience in .NET development with a strong focus on C#;
- Technical knowledge on: ASP.NET Core, Angular 16+, Web API, object-oriented programming concepts and testing (unit testing, performance, );
- Extensive hands-on experience with common Azure concepts (security, computing, storage, );
- Knowledge on applying security principles (JWT, OAUTH, );
- Expertise on advanced design concepts (CQRS, domain driven design, ...);
- Experience with Docker and Azure Kubernetes Service (AKS) for containerization and orchestration of microservices is a plus;
- Passion for the whole software development and improvement process;
- Result driven, able to work against deadlines;
- Capable of working in a dynamic project environment;
- Able to work independently as well as in team;
- Willing to learn and apply new technologies and best practices;
- Fluent in English.
DUTIES
- Design, develop, and maintain robust and scalable applications using .NET technologies;
- Utilize Azure cloud services for application deployment, management, and scalability;
- Engage in code reviews and provide constructive feedback to ensure code quality and adherence to best practices;
- Create documentation for developed code;
- Troubleshoot and resolve errors/issues;
- Share experience and knowledge with team members;
- Coach and guide team members in development areas;
- Analyze and translate business requirements;
- Apply coding best practices and guidelines;
- Other duties as assigned.
Keyskills: Angular 16+ Azure services net with C sharp Web Api
We are CirrusLabs. Our vision is to become the world's most sought-after niche digital transformation company that helps customers realize value through innovation. Our mission is to co-create success with our customers, partners and community. Our goal is to enable employees to dream, grow and make...